source: roaraudio/tests/common.sh @ 5870:4ea810a09919

Last change on this file since 5870:4ea810a09919 was 5870:4ea810a09919, checked in by phi, 11 years ago

Also set PATH so tests works on win32 as well (Closes: #341) (pr1)

  • Property exe set to *
File size: 661 bytes
Line 
1#!/bin/sh
2
3PWD=`pwd`
4PF="$PWD/sandbox"
5
6LIB_PATH="$PF/$PREFIX_LIB"
7
8if [ "$LD_LIBRARY_PATH" = '' ]
9then
10 export LD_LIBRARY_PATH="$LIB_PATH"
11else
12 export LD_LIBRARY_PATH="$LIB_PATH:$LD_LIBRARY_PATH"
13fi
14export PATH="$LIB_PATH:$PATH"
15export BIN_PATH="$PF/$PREFIX_BIN"
16
17OK=0
18FAILED=0
19
20if [ "$TEST_NAME" != '' ]
21then
22 echo "Test Name       : $TEST_NAME"
23 if [ "$TEST_DESC" != '' ]
24 then
25  echo "Test Description: $TEST_DESC"
26 fi
27 echo '---------------------'
28fi
29
30_ok() {
31 OK=`expr $OK + 1`
32}
33_failed() {
34 FAILED=`expr $FAILED + 1`
35}
36
37disp_sum() {
38 SUM=`expr $OK + $FAILED`
39 echo
40 echo "Done $SUM tests: $OK ok, $FAILED failed."
41 echo
42}
43
44ret() {
45 exit $FAILED
46}
47
48#ll
Note: See TracBrowser for help on using the repository browser.